description
Northern Trains Limited intends to directly award British Telecommunications Limited the contract for the supply of SIM cards and data provision services. This decision is based on our established partnership with British Telecommunications Limited, which already supplies various data sources integral to Northern's operations.
Northern Trains Limited operates fleets of trains equipped with sophisticated hardware that relies on onboard routers to facilitate seamless communication while in transit. To ensure the continued functionality and operational efficiency of these systems, as well as Northern's comprehensive data management infrastructure, it is imperative to maintain compatibility with the SIM cards provided by British Telecommunications Limited. Following an evaluation process, alternative Mobile Network Operators were found incapable of meeting Northern's commercial requirements for maintaining the existing routers on our fleet nor meet the technical requirements for interoperability and the essential availability required by our systems.
This direct award to British Telecommunications Limited is essential for ensuring uninterrupted service provision and maintaining the high standards of service and reliability that our passengers expect and deserve.
